Oritavancin
A single-dose lipoglycopeptide with three separate mechanisms against gram-positive bacteria, useful for one-and-done skin infection treatment but notorious for scrambling coagulation lab tests for days afterwards.
Also known as lipoglycopeptide, oritavancin diphosphate, Orbactiv, Kimyrsa, LY333328
Approved drug — Licensed by a major regulator for human use, with phase-3 trial data behind it.
FDA-approved in 2014 on the SOLO I and SOLO II randomised non-inferiority trials against twice-daily vancomycin in acute bacterial skin infection. Use outside skin infection, including for bacteraemia or osteomyelitis, is not supported by randomised data and is complicated by the osteomyelitis signal in the pivotal trials.
How it works
Oritavancin is a semisynthetic derivative of the vancomycin relative chloroeremomycin. Like all glycopeptides it binds the D-Ala-D-Ala terminus of lipid II, but its hydrophobic biphenyl side chain also anchors it in the membrane and allows a second interaction with the pentaglycyl bridging segment of peptidoglycan — a site that vanA-modified precursors do not alter, which is why oritavancin retains activity against vancomycin-resistant enterococci. Its third mechanism is direct membrane depolarisation and permeabilisation, giving it rapid concentration-dependent bactericidal activity uncommon for a glycopeptide. Its terminal half-life of about ten days comes from extensive tissue distribution and slow release. The molecule also binds phospholipid reagents in coagulation assays, artefactually prolonging aPTT for up to 48 hours and PT/INR for up to 24 hours after a dose.

Titration
No dose adjustment for mild to moderate renal or hepatic impairment. Severe impairment has not been studied.
Cycling
One dose is the complete course. Repeat dosing within a fortnight has not been studied and is not recommended.

Mixing
Each 400 mg Orbactiv vial takes 40 mL of sterile water; three vials are needed per dose. Swirl, do not shake. Orbactiv is incompatible with saline — use dextrose only, and flush the line with dextrose before and after.
Side effects
- very commonInterference with coagulation tests— Artefactually prolongs aPTT for up to 48 hours and PT/INR for up to 24 hours. It does not actually cause bleeding, but it makes heparin monitoring impossible and has led to inappropriate transfusion when misread.
- commonNausea and vomiting
- commonHeadache
- commonInfusion-site reactions and phlebitis— Three-hour infusion of a large-volume dextrose solution irritates peripheral veins.
- uncommonOsteomyelitis in trial patients— More cases of osteomyelitis were reported in the oritavancin arms of the phase 3 trials than in comparators; the label carries this as a warning.
- uncommonHypersensitivity reactions— Can appear days after the dose given the long half-life.
Do not use if
- Intravenous unfractionated heparin sodium within 48 hours of an oritavancin dose — this is a labelled contraindication because aPTT becomes uninterpretable.
- Known hypersensitivity to oritavancin or other glycopeptides.
- Not appropriate where gram-negative or anaerobic coverage is required.
Combining it
- conflictunfractionated heparin — Contraindicated for 48 hours after a dose because aPTT-guided heparin dosing cannot be performed safely.
- cautionwarfarin — Oritavancin is a weak CYP2C9 inhibitor and also distorts INR measurement, so warfarin control becomes unreliable for a day or more.
- redundantdalbavancin — Same clinical niche; dalbavancin avoids the coagulation-assay problem.
What to monitor
- · Do not use aPTT-based heparin monitoring for 48 hours after dosing; use anti-Xa levels instead if anticoagulation is required.
- · Clinical wound and cellulitis assessment at 48-72 hours.
- · Because a single dose lingers for weeks, any hypersensitivity reaction needs supportive management rather than drug withdrawal.

What usually goes wrong
The coagulation assay interference is the trap. A prolonged aPTT after oritavancin looks like a bleeding disorder, and acting on it - withholding anticoagulation, transfusing, investigating - is a response to an artefact. It also makes unfractionated heparin unmonitorable for that window, so heparin is contraindicated for 48 hours after a dose.
